Christian Bale looks unreal as Al Davis in new movie photos

Christian Bale is set to play a starring role in an upcoming movie about the life of John Madden, and he looks absolutely incredible in character.

Bale, who won an Academy Award for his role in “The Fighter,” will be playing the role of late former Raiders owner Al Davis. Davis was the owner of the Raiders and ran the franchise from 1972 until his death in 2011. He also served as the team’s head coach from 1963-1965 before becoming a part-time owner, all while the team was part of the AFL.

While Nicolas Cage will be portraying Madden, Bale looks incredible as Davis. Take a look at some of the photos.

The hair. The tinted glasses. The clothes. The facial expressions. Man, Bale has it all.

Cage dressing up as Madden may need some getting used to, but Bale really seems to have the look of Davis down already.

The movie is being made by Amazon MGM Studios and directed by David O’Russell. It looks like it will be one worth watching.
